Step 1
Heat a large, deep skillet over medium high heat.
Step 2
Add the kielbasa to the skillet and sear on all sides until heated through.
Step 3
Transfer the kielbasa to a platter and keep warm.
Step 4
Add the olive oil to the pan and stir in the onion.
Step 5
Cook the onion until slightly softened and caramelized.
Step 6
Stir in the apples and cook until softened.
Step 7
Add the garlic, thyme and caraway seeds to the pan cooking for 1 minute.
Step 8
Stir in the sauerkraut and brown sugar tossing everything to combine.
Step 9
Add the kielbasa back to the pan. Stir in the apple cider and beef stock.
Step 10
Continue cooking until most of the liquid is absorbed.
Step 11
Serve immediately.
